The JCS junket has been picking up steam. This started as a series of 40th anniversary screenings (to promote the release of the new Blu-ray) with a little Q&A before and after at the end of last month. Some were Neeley solo, some were Neeley and Dennen, mainly in California. Now it's at least two full-cast gatherings that I know of.
